モダンな JDK 25
仮想スレッド、パターンマッチング、ZGC。最新の機能をすべて備えています。
すべてが最適化され、本番環境対応です。
仮想スレッド、パターンマッチング、ZGC。最新の機能をすべて備えています。
サーバー上に Maven/Gradle は不要。ローカルでビルドすれば、Square が実行します。
fat JAR としてパッケージ化された、あらゆる JVM 言語が動作します。
START= 経由でフラグを設定できます(例: java -Xms256m -Xmx900m -jar app.jar)。
このランタイムが当社のプラットフォームで真価を発揮する場面。
仮想スレッド、低レイテンシ、最適化された起動を備えた REST、GraphQL、gRPC。
JDA、Discord4J、Javacord の Bot を、分離されたコンテナで 24 時間 365 日ホスティングします。
gRPC、Protobuf、非同期メッセージングによる型付き通信を、エンタープライズ規模で実現します。
Ktor、Spring + Kotlin、コルーチンファーストのアーキテクチャを備えたモダンなバックエンドを本番環境で運用できます。
YouTube、SoundCloud、Spotify に対応したスタンドアロンの Lavalink。WebSocket 経由で Discord Bot を接続します。
堅牢な JVM 環境上で、Spring Batch、Quartz Scheduler のジョブ、ETL データパイプラインを実行します。
プロジェクトに最も適したトラックを選びましょう。
現在のバージョン
25
単一の安定したツールチェーン
アプリを設定するために必要なすべて。
.jarpom.xmlbuild.gradlebuild.gradle.ktsjavaプロジェクトのルートに squarecloud.app ファイルを作成します:
MEMORY=512
DISPLAY_NAME=Meu App
VERSION=recommended
MAIN=app.jar小さく始めて、必要なときにスケール。縛り契約はありません。
JDK 25、fat JAR、Spring Boot、Lavalink サーバー。